Job description

Job Title: Accounts Assistant

Reports to: Finance Manager

Contract Type: Permanent, Full-time

Hours: 37.5 hours per week (office-based with flexibility)

Role Purpose

The Accounts Assistant (with strong credit control) will provide comprehensive administrative and financial support to the accounts department. This is an excellent opportunity for an organised and proactive individual who has strong attention to detail and a solid foundation in accounting processes.

You will work as part of a collaborative finance team of eight, liaising with colleagues across the wider business and maintaining professional communication with high-value clients.

Key Responsibilities
  • Processing sales invoices, including deposits and balance payments
  • Supplier statement reconciliations
  • Managing credit control administration
  • Chasing outstanding debts directly with clients
  • Reconciling customer accounts and resolving account queries
  • Handling credit card and cheque payments received via phone or post
  • Posting and allocating cash accurately
  • Providing day-to-day administrative support across the finance team
  • Maintaining accurate financial records and general ledger entries
  • Updating and managing the cash book
  • Supporting colleagues within the finance team as required
